Ceylonese
English
Etymology
Ceylon + -ese
Adjective
Ceylonese (comparative more Ceylonese, superlative most Ceylonese)
- Of or pertaining to Ceylon.

Noun
Ceylonese (plural Ceyloneses or Ceylonese)
- A native of Ceylon.
